Replacement keys
It is essential to have a spare key for your Saab 9-3 in the event that one is lost or damaged. If you don't have a spare key, the process of replacing a lost or damaged key fob can take a long time and costly. Fortunately, there are some simple actions you can take to accelerate the process.
To remove an unlocked manual key from a SAAB 9-3 key fob, insert an flathead screwdriver into the slot in the middle of the case. The screwdriver should be gently moved around the edges of the key fob until it splits open. If the key fob is stuck do not try to force it to move. Instead try lubricating it using some petroleum jelly or wax.
The latest Saab models include a special computer, the CIM or the TWICE module. It communicates directly with the key. The key fob has to be connected to the CIM, and programmed. The car cannot read keys that have not been paired to the CIM.
It is also important to know that all newer Saab automobiles come with immobilizers that are designed to guard against theft. The immobilizers utilize an electronic chip to recognize the code of the key, and will not start the engine if not the correct code. This feature is very useful in preventing theft of your vehicle, and is a good reason to keep an extra key in the event you lose or damage the one you have originally.
Key fobs replacement
You're hoping to replace your lost car keys as soon as you can. It is possible that you don't have any spares, and it's expensive to purchase them from the dealer. You can instead find locksmiths that specialize in making replacement keys fobs for cars. They usually start at $120, which is considerably lower than what a dealership will charge you.
The key fobs that lock and unlock your car have batteries and they will eventually die over time. To replace the battery on your SAAB 9-3, you'll have to open the case of the key fob. Insert an open-ended flathead into the slot inside the middle case. After you have opened the case, you can remove the emergency key and change the battery.
